Insurance Copays, Deductibles and Mental Health Parity

In accordance with the Mental Health Parity and Addiction Equity Act of 2008, prior benefit limits for Behavioral Health and AODA services have been removed.  In the past, mental health benefits have been set aside as a separate coverage with limits as to number of sessions and maximum expenditure on services allowed.  This is no longer the case.  Behavioral Health and AODA diagnoses are to be treated by insurance companies the same as medical diagnoses.  Effective with all policy renewals on or after November 1, 2009, depending on your particular health insurance policy, insurance companies may now require you to pay a deductible, a copay, or both.
